G Gamba is a scholar working on Hematology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, G Gamba has authored 67 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 32 papers in Hematology, 12 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 11 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in G Gamba’s work include Platelet Disorders and Treatments (16 papers), Hemophilia Treatment and Research (15 papers) and Blood properties and coagulation (8 papers). G Gamba is often cited by papers focused on Platelet Disorders and Treatments (16 papers), Hemophilia Treatment and Research (15 papers) and Blood properties and coagulation (8 papers). G Gamba coll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Mexico and United States. G Gamba's co-authors include Nadia Montani, Giovanni Grignani, Patrizia Noris, L Pacchiarini and Edoardo Ascari and has published in prestigious journals such as New England Journal of Medicine, Circulation and The American Journal of Medicine.
